INTRODUCTION

• Distance education is an alternative mode for receiving the highest


professional and technical education which distinguishes from
conventional campus based mode of learning.
• Distance education is a formal educational process in which
majority of the instruction occurs when student and instructor are
not in same place.
DEFINITION

Distance education , also called distance learning , is the education of students


Who may not always be physically present at a school. Traditionally, this
usually involved correspondence courses wherein the student corresponded
with the school via mail, Today , It involves online education.

Online distance education also meets the needs of students who prefer more
independence in their learning. ( Leasure, Davis, and Thievon,2000)
OBJECTIVES:
• To advance and disseminate learning and knowledge by a diversity of means.
• To provide a second opportunity to study to those who missed such an
opportunity earlier.
• There is shortage of scientific and technical manpower in some countries and
the tradition system is unable to cope with the demand
• To improve the quality and standarad of education
• It reduces pressure of the secondary education students.
• It facilitate the provision of our constitution ie equalization of education
opportunity.

RESEARCH AND DISTANCE EDUCATION

• Research comparing distance education to tradition


face to face instruction indicates that teaching and
studying at a distance can be as effective as
traditional instruction.
